Police say that one person was killed following a collision that led to a big rig fire on a Memphis interstate on Sunday afternoon.
The incident occurred around 4:20 p.m. on Sunday, April 7, on I-40 at Sycamore View Drive.
The Memphis Police Department reports that a two vehicle accident occurred in the eastbound lanes of I-40.
Following the crash, the semi truck became completely engulfed in flames.
One person was reported dead at the scene.
Another person was hospitalized with non-critical injuries.
The incident is under investigation.
